Abstract

Multi arc ion plating ZrTiN hard coatings were deposited on WC/TiC/Co and WC/Co cemented carbide substrate with independent Ti and Zr targets. The effect of deposition time on morphology, phase composition, thickness, hardness and adhesive strength of the coatings was investigated, respectively. The results show that only face centered cubic structure phase forms in the coatings and the crystal orientation maintains (111). Grain size of the coating is around 10 nm without changing during experimental process. Microhardness and adhesive strength of the coatings decline evidently when deposition time is 120 min.
